The time capsule from the early to mid-1980's underground Bay Area Thrash Metal scene has finally been excavated for the whole world to see.....man was it worth the wait! Harald Oimoen & Brian Lew have finally and properly unleashed 272 pages of pure metal debauchery during its finest hours. The majority of the pictures span the years 1982 through 1985. The shots depict the loyal and aggressive Bay Area underground scene with drunken, violent, and devilish behavior, meanwhile raging to their local heroes Exodus & Metallica, while Slayer and Megadeth making it their second home. The majority of pictures I have seen before and was well aware of who snapped them, but for people who haven't seen most of them, it's great that Harald O & Brian Lew FINALLY get their due! Plus, the pictures have really come to life in this great photo spread! Bazillion Points did an outstanding job with the layout and overall clarity of the pictures. As I sat totally engrossed in this book when it arrived at my front door, I wondered "What if these two guys never took these pictures?" All of these shots were basically "inner circle" pictures.....friends taking pictures of friends. A whole time period would be just erased and would have been.....well just stories! It's interesting to note, almost all the shots in this book do not contain the now mainstream & grossly over used "devil horn" sign, which was a breath of fresh air!
